- [ ] Key ceremony, step 7: rotate the signing key used by Twigreaper, the stale-branch cleanup bot. Verify the old key is revoked in the registry before the bot's next sweep. Document witnesses in the ceremony log. To unseal the ceremony token, type the passphrase shown directly below.

recovery phrase for bawep-kawef: oliath-casdor

- [ ] Step 7: Archive cold storage buckets (Glacierline tier). Confirm both ceremony witnesses are present, verify bucket manifests match the Oxbow ledger, then seal the archive key shares. Plugin authors may observe but not handle shares. Once sealed, the archive index itself is encrypted and can only be reopened with the passphrase below.

vault phrase of badup-hahig = tamael-aldael-kelmir-istael-fenok-istwyn-tamius-jorath-oliion

**Vendor note: Inkmill markdown pipeline**

Rendering for Parchway docs is outsourced to Inkmill under an annual contract, renewing each March. They handle sanitization and PDF export; we own the upload queue. SLA: 4-hour response on rendering failures. Escalate only after two failed retries. Their support desk is reachable at the address below.

billing contact of hahaf-baguf = zorael.tammir.jorius@sivrelhq.internal